All you have to do is tip a quarter teaspoon of peppermint extract into two cups … WebJan 18, 2024 · Because of this, peppermint oil is used in lower amounts than peppermint extract. Furthermore, peppermint oil doesn’t evaporate quickly, even in high temperatures. In comparison, peppermint extract can evaporate very quickly because of its high alcohol content.
